You will need to crank it up and cause a metabolic disruption in your body to continue losing fat. Variety is the best thing about life, both inside and outside the gym. Your mental and physical fitness will improve if you are constantly challenging yourself. It is obvious that if you get bored with your current routine, it will not work. So don’t let your workouts get stale!

  • You can change up the weight training exercises to include new or different exercises. You can use different rep ranges, different angles, and shorter rest periods.
  • For cardio, stop slaving on the treadmill and start using bodyweight exercises and dumbbell or barbell complexes. This allows you to superset without stopping at any one exercise. You will burn a lot of calories quickly by using all your major muscles and increasing your heart rate.
  • As for your plan, don’t drop your calories too low, too fast. This is a sure-fire way to lose muscle mass and slow down your metabolism. To make sure you aren’t consuming hidden calories, take a look at your diet for a few days.
